There was something for everyone at the ICA this week when Emmy-nominated actor Oliver Platt joined former US poet laureate Robert Pinsky to read stories by composer John Cage during a performance of Merce Cunningham’s “How to Pass, Kick, Fall & Run.” (Got all that?) The event, staged by former Cunningham dancer Rashaun Mitchell, was part of Summer Stages Dance at Concord Academy’s 2012 Meet the Artist Performance Series and Summer Stages/Up Close.
